Best Fabrics and Materials for a Chicken Drawstring Fabric Bag Pattern
Selecting the right materials is essential when creating a beautiful Chicken drawstring fabric bag pattern. Cotton fabric is one of the most popular choices because it is durable, easy to sew, and available in countless prints and colors. Quilting cotton works especially well for chicken-themed bags because it holds shape nicely while remaining soft and flexible.
Canvas fabric is another excellent option for a Chicken drawstring fabric bag pattern if extra durability is desired. Canvas provides a stronger structure, making the bag suitable for carrying heavier items or frequent use. Some crafters combine cotton prints with canvas linings for both decorative appeal and added strength.
Drawstring cords or ribbons are important design elements for these fabric bags. Cotton cord, satin ribbon, jute twine, or braided fabric ties can all create different visual effects. Rustic farmhouse-style bags often use natural twine or gingham ribbon, while modern designs may include colorful satin cords or decorative rope handles.
Decorative details can make a Chicken drawstring fabric bag pattern even more unique. Appliqué chicken shapes, embroidered feathers, patchwork details, or decorative buttons can enhance the final appearance. Some sewing enthusiasts also enjoy adding lace trims, ruffles, or quilted sections to create a more detailed and elegant design.
Interfacing is commonly used to add structure and stability to fabric bags. Lightweight interfacing helps the bag maintain its shape without becoming too stiff. Depending on the desired look, sewers may choose fusible interfacing for convenience or sew-in interfacing for softer flexibility.
Thread selection is equally important for a successful Chicken drawstring fabric bag pattern. High-quality thread helps create strong seams and professional-looking stitches. Matching or contrasting thread colors can either blend seamlessly into the design or create decorative accents that highlight specific details of the project.

Helpful Sewing Tips for a Chicken Drawstring Fabric Bag Pattern
Careful fabric preparation is an important first step when making a Chicken drawstring fabric bag pattern. Washing and ironing fabric before sewing helps prevent shrinking and ensures accurate cutting. Smooth fabric pieces also make sewing easier and improve the final appearance of the finished bag.
Accurate measuring and cutting are essential for creating symmetrical fabric bags. Using a rotary cutter, quilting ruler, or sharp fabric scissors helps produce clean and precise edges. Careful preparation reduces sewing mistakes and creates a more professional result.
When sewing a Chicken drawstring fabric bag pattern, beginners should pay attention to seam allowances. Consistent seam allowances help maintain proper bag proportions and ensure that pieces fit together correctly. Marking guidelines with fabric chalk or washable markers can improve accuracy during assembly.
Choosing the correct needle for the fabric type is also important. Lightweight cotton fabrics generally work well with universal sewing needles, while heavier canvas fabrics may require stronger needles designed for thicker materials. Proper needle selection improves stitch quality and reduces sewing machine issues.
Testing the drawstring channel before finishing the bag is another helpful sewing tip. Ensuring that the ribbon or cord moves smoothly through the casing prevents frustration later. Some sewers use safety pins or bodkins to guide the drawstring through the fabric channel more easily.
